    How come this was broadcast in 1981 when the Compact disc was first introduced in 1982?

    • @LarryDors
      @LarryDors Před 21 dnem

      Tomorrow's World always shown new technology before it was available to the public. Many times it was a prototype that was very different to the final product sold. There should be more information in my Jam Spreading Myth video at czcams.com/video/Z5AUduID2P4/video.html and the page n my site at orchardoo.com/jam.

    • @LarryDors
      @LarryDors Před 3 měsíci

      The BBC Micro had three mono music channels plus one noise channel. I used a technique that combined one music channel with the noise channel to get a bass sound, so I couldm't add any percussive sounds using noise. As for a 'more accurate' version, well I wouldn't normally offer help at finding the competition (in 1985) but the BBC and Master Computer Public Domain Library at 8bs.com/catalogue/bbc.htm has many disc images of music (mine included). You will need an BBC Emulator to play them, but information is on the site.
